The Benefits of Massage
Why do more and more people are getting themselves a therapeutic massage more often? A number of reasons why will be briefly discussed in this article.
Therapeutic massage is beneficial in many ways and those who have taken themselves to massage centers can attest to this.
One, it aids in the recovery or healing process. It is inevitable for anyone exposed to strenuous exercise or activity to not feel tired and overly stressed. However, fast and efficient recovery may come to the rescue in the form of therapeutic massage. Such a recovery can include improved blood and lymph circulation, muscle relaxation and overall relaxation. Consequently, these lead to extraction of waste products and improved cell nutrition, stabilization of tissues, neutralization of trigger points, and faster healing of injuries which can result to relief from soreness and stiffness, enhanced flexibility, and reduced likelihood of future injury.
Two, it aids trigger the relaxation response. Over-training which is often associated with irritability, apathy, loss of appetite, insomnia and many more often occurs during heavy exercise or workout. However, therapeutic massage could thwart over-training because it stimulates relaxation. It relaxes tense muscles.
Three, it aids in relieving stress. Massage does help balance the effects of stress in our lives, reduce anxiety level and tension headaches, normalize blocked energy flow, improve the functioning of the immune system and restore a calm mind and feeling of well-being. What could be more rewarding then than a stress-free life or a stress-free day.
While the aforementioned benefits are quite obvious, studies have found out that massage is much more beneficial in treating depression, anxiety and many more emotional issues rather than the physical issues or those associated with physical pain.
